最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
如何在快速发展的编程世界中保持竞争力?
随着科技的飞速发展,编程行业正经历着前所未有的变革。对于程序员来说,如何在这个竞争激烈的环境中保持竞争力成为了至关重要的问题。面对不断涌现的新技术、新工具和新方法,程序员需要找到一种高效的方式来提升自己的技能,紧跟时代的步伐。本文将探讨程序员如何利用智能化工具软件来增强自身的竞争力,并重点介绍一款革命性的AI编程工具——它不仅能帮助程序员提高效率,还能让他们在复杂多变的技术浪潮中立于不败之地。
一、持续学习与技能更新
编程行业的快速发展意味着新技术层出不穷,旧的知识和技能可能很快过时。因此,持续学习是程序员保持竞争力的关键。然而,学习新知识并非易事,尤其是在时间有限的情况下。此时,智能化工具可以为程序员提供巨大的帮助。
以InsCode AI IDE为例,这款由CSDN、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境,不仅提供了高效的编程体验,还内置了强大的AI对话框。通过这个对话框,程序员可以输入自然语言描述,快速生成代码片段或修改现有代码。这种基于自然语言的交互方式极大地简化了编程过程,使得即使是复杂的算法也能轻松实现。此外,InsCode AI IDE还支持全局代码生成/改写,能够理解整个项目并生成或修改多个文件,包括图片资源等。
二、提高编程效率
在编程过程中,编写高质量的代码不仅需要深厚的技术功底,还需要大量的时间和精力。传统的编程方式往往耗时且容易出错,而智能化工具则可以帮助程序员显著提高编程效率。
InsCode AI IDE在这方面表现尤为突出。它具备智能问答功能,允许用户通过自然对话与IDE互动,解决编程中的各种挑战,如代码解析、语法指导、优化建议等。同时,它还支持代码补全、智能注释添加、单元测试生成等功能,大大减少了手动编写代码的时间。例如,在编写Web应用时,程序员可以通过自然语言描述页面布局,InsCode AI IDE会自动生成HTML、CSS和JavaScript代码,甚至可以直接调用第三方API进行数据处理。
三、优化代码质量和性能
除了提高编程效率,代码质量和性能也是衡量程序员竞争力的重要标准。高质量的代码不仅易于维护,还能减少错误和Bug的发生。InsCode AI IDE通过其强大的AI功能,帮助程序员优化代码质量和性能。
该工具内置了代码分析模块,能够自动检测代码中的潜在问题,并提供详细的修改建议。例如,在编写Python程序时,InsCode AI IDE可以识别出性能瓶颈,并给出优化方案,从而提升代码的执行效率。此外,它还支持修复错误和优化代码的功能,确保代码在不同环境下都能稳定运行。这些特性使得程序员能够在短时间内完成高质量的代码开发,极大提升了工作效率。
四、适应多语言和多框架开发
现代编程环境要求程序员掌握多种编程语言和框架,以应对不同类型的应用开发需求。然而,掌握多种语言和框架并非易事,需要大量的时间和实践。智能化工具可以帮助程序员更轻松地适应多语言和多框架开发。
InsCode AI IDE内置了对多种编程语言的支持,包括Java、JavaScript、TypeScript、HTML、CSS、SCSS和JSON等。无论是Web开发、移动应用开发还是后端服务开发,InsCode AI IDE都能提供相应的编码辅助功能。例如,在开发Java应用程序时,程序员可以使用InsCode AI IDE的Java语言支持和编码辅助功能,快速构建高性能的企业级应用。而在前端开发中,InsCode AI IDE的HTML、CSS和JavaScript支持则能让程序员轻松创建美观且功能丰富的网页。
五、个性化定制与扩展
每个程序员的工作方式和需求都不同,因此一个理想的编程工具应该具备高度的可定制性和扩展性。InsCode AI IDE在这方面表现出色,它提供了丰富的设置选项和众多扩展插件,允许用户根据自己的喜好和需求进行个性化定制。
例如,程序员可以根据自己的习惯调整编辑器的外观和功能,选择适合自己的键盘快捷键和主题样式。此外,InsCode AI IDE还支持VSCode插件和CodeArts插件框架,用户可以从Open VSX社区获取更多优质的插件资源,进一步丰富开发环境。这种高度灵活的定制化能力使得InsCode AI IDE成为了一个真正个性化的开发工具,满足了不同程序员的需求。
六、结语:拥抱智能化工具,迎接未来挑战
在当今快速发展的编程世界中,程序员要想保持竞争力,必须不断学习新技术、提高编程效率、优化代码质量、适应多语言和多框架开发,并根据自身需求进行个性化定制。智能化工具如InsCode AI IDE无疑是程序员的最佳助手,它不仅提供了高效的编程体验,还帮助程序员解决了许多实际问题,使他们在竞争激烈的编程行业中脱颖而出。
如果你也想在编程领域保持竞争力,不妨下载并试用InsCode AI IDE,体验它带来的便捷与高效。相信你会感受到这款智能化工具的强大功能和巨大价值,助力你在编程道路上越走越远。
448

被折叠的 条评论
为什么被折叠?



